The first American autonomous ground vehicles are fighting in Ukraine

Forterra has deployed over 100 autonomous ground vehicles in Ukraine to assist with logistics and defense operations. These gas-powered vehicles are being used to navigate dangerous combat zones where aerial surveillance makes traditional transport vulnerable.
Forterra , a US builder of autonomous vehicles, revealed today that more than 100 of its self-driving ATVs have been deployed in conflict zones in Ukraine for the past nine months, in what the company believes is the largest deployment of autonomous ground vehicles in combat by any US defense tech company.
